Dog hero saves the


neighborhood Harley, a Lab-border collie mix,


woke up his family at 1:45 a.m. Valentine’s Day eve. He was agi- tated, growling and directing Or- ange residents Liz and Steve Fla- nagan to their sliding back door. Alerted by Harley’s “strange


behavior,” Steve Flanagan went to investigate, and discovered that a large eucalyptus tree on the property behind their home -- and just 10 feet from their neigh- bor’s fence -- was fully engulfed in flames. Embers were blowing onto nearby houses. The Flanagans called 911 and


alerted their neighbors, who were all sound asleep. The fire depart- ment arrived in time to quash the flames before they spread. The Flanagans and their neighbors credit Harley with saving their houses from a potential inferno.
